Background

Eric Friddell is a Principal on the investment team at W Capital Partners, a New York-based private-equity firm founded in 2001 that specializes in providing shareholder liquidity through direct secondary and GP-led transactions. In his role he focuses on the analysis and execution of new investment opportunities and on supporting the firm's existing portfolio companies. W Capital manages more than $1.6 billion and has completed over 70 portfolio transactions across more than 100 private-equity- and venture-backed companies.

Friddell joined W Capital Partners in 2016. He came from Credit Suisse's Financial Institutions Group, where he worked on M&A and corporate-finance transactions for a range of public and private global clients. He earned a B.S. in Commerce from the University of Virginia's McIntire School, concentrating in Finance and Accounting.

As part of his portfolio responsibilities, Friddell has held board and board-observer roles at W Capital investments, including BeatGig (a live-music booking and event-hosting platform), CollegeNET (a SaaS provider serving higher-education institutions), PlayYourCourt (a platform connecting tennis players with instructors), and Flag & Anthem (a men's apparel brand). Some aggregator profiles list his title as "Vice President" or "Senior Associate," reflecting earlier stages of his tenure; W Capital's own team page currently lists him as Principal.

Investment Thesis & Focus

  • Invests through direct secondaries — buying common and preferred shares directly in underlying private companies from existing shareholders seeking liquidity, rather than leading primary financing rounds.
  • Firm has "a particular interest in growth-equity secondary investments as well as buyout minority secondary investments."
  • Provides liquidity to GPs, VC firms, financial institutions, corporations, company founders, and lenders holding illiquid, minority positions in private companies.
  • Transaction sizes generally range from roughly $20M to $200M+, deployed across the U.S. and Europe.
  • The firm frames GP-led secondaries as a core, high-growth strategy: "Since W Capital began providing secondary liquidity to GPs more than two decades ago, GP-leds have become a high-growth and broadly accepted strategy."
